MULTI-AXIS PNEUMATIC VORTEX CONTROL AT HIGH SPEED AND LOW ANGLE-OF-ATTACK
- Researched the dynamic modeling and control of multi-axis Pneumatic Vortex Control (PVC) devices as applied to fighter-type aircraft at high speeds and low angles-of-attack. Constructed a high fidelity nonlinear, non real-time, six degree-of-freedom simulation code of the F-16XL equipped with forebody, wing, and vertical tail PVC devices. Evaluated required engine bleed air massflow levels and controller requirements for large amplitude, full envelope test maneuvers, including simulated tactical penetration strike missions.

CHARACTERIZATION AND ENHANCEMENT OF THE SPACE STATION REMOTE MANIPULATOR SYSTEM (SSRMS) AND ITS OPERATION
- Research focused on conceiving and developing devices such as the End Point Control Unit (shown below), control laws, control strategies, and performance characterizations to enhance the telerobotic arm slated for installation on the International Space Station.
